摘要
Equations that describe the nonequilibrium differential capacitance C of an electrode subjected to adsorption of organic molecules under the conditions where this adsorption strictly follows the generalized model of the surface layer (GMSL) are derived. Using the developed programs, the dependences of C (omega) on the electrode potential phi at different concentrations of an organic substance are calculated. A regression analysis procedure is developed that allows one to obtain a set of GMSL parameters describing the dense layer capacitance in NaF solutions with different contents of n-C4H9OH.
